Home Tags Natural Bridge Caverns

Tag: Natural Bridge Caverns

Best and Fun Things to Do in San Antonio, Texas

Looking for the best things to do in San Antonio?? Here's the list with all the information that you need when planning your family...

Amazing Caverns in Texas, United States

Looking for caverns in Texas?? Here's the list of amazing caverns in Texas, United States. Texas is a large and beautiful state in the United...